Authorize the City Manager to execute a Community Facilities Agreement with BP 367 Fort Worth Limited, by BP 367 Fort Worth GP, L.L.C., its General Partner, for the installation of sewer services to serve Primrose Crossing, a future single-family home development, located in far southwest Fort Worth. DISCUSSION: BP 367 Fort Worth Limited, by BP 367 Fort Worth GP, L.L.C., its General Partner, the developer of Primrose Crossing, has executed a proposed contract for community facilities to serve a single-family development located in the far southwest part of Fort Worth, along Brewer Boulevard and west of Summer Creek Boulevard (see attached map). The total cost for sewer improvements for this development is $160,249. There will be City participation in sewer pipe (18"/12", 15"/8", 12"/8") oversizing to increase pipe capacity in the drainage area. The developer and City estimated costs for sewer improvements are subject to construction inspection fees.
